Engine Spare Parts
Get Price Quote
Engine Spare Parts, Actuators, Speed Governor, turbocharger parts
Engine Spare Parts
Get Price Quote
Engine Spare Parts, Protecting Window, medical lasers, scientific instrument
Best Deals from Engine Spare Parts